Moral Stories by Jayadayal Goyandka, a renowned spiritual and literary figure from the Gita Press tradition, is a timeless collection of inspiring tales that teach the values of truth, honesty, kindness, and self-discipline. Each story is written in a simple, engaging style, making it easy for children and adults alike to understand profound life lessons.
This book serves as a standalone guide to character building, helping readers cultivate virtues that form the foundation of a meaningful life. Whether read at home, in schools, or during storytelling sessions, these stories leave a lasting impression on young minds.
